I am headed on a hunt in 2 weeks. I just shipped my bowUPS with 1,100 dollars worth of insurance on it. The bow will be aweek early on the other end. Over sized heavy bow cases may cost 50.00 extra on the airlines.

One of the guys that I will be hunting with, came to Idaho last year, and his bow was in Denver 3 days into the hunt. He too likes the UPS Idea, the shipping cost was 22.85. I boxed up extra labels and will ship it back.

If you want it to go with you, SKB would be my choice. However if you are heading to Africa, it may be best to find a way to pack it in your duffle bag!!!

I have several different makes of flight cases including Americase and Anvil but I picked up a SKB4 rifle case last for about $200 and really like it. It's purpose was to save on luggage pieces due to a person has a limit of 2 ea. I went on a hunt with 2 others and was able to put all rifles in one piece of baggage allowing 2 friends more baggage. I have also used it as a bow case and it has plenty of room for everything. I usually try to get it right up to the 50lb limit.In hunting cold enviroments , for me anyways it's hard to meet the international weight limits of 50 lbs.
